Overview
Join the Indiana State Nurses Association for a recorded lunch time briefing on the Indiana General Assembly’s 2026 session and what it means for nursing practice, education, and patient care. You’ll learn the status of priority legislation and how these changes could affect your role as a nurse in Indiana.
Learning Objectives
- Describe current state legislative activity relevant to nursing practice, patient care, and the broader healthcare system.
- Identify key bills under consideration and summarize their intent, scope, and potential impact on nursing and patient outcomes.
- Explain the legislative process and where the highlighted bills currently sit within the process.
